When I worked at the Chamber of Commerce we got the
Mavica that uses CDs for the reason that anyone can
read a floppy or CD without needing to have special
software.  (I don't know about Macs though.)  It had a
macro mode, I called it "bug" mode that worked very
well.  When I get my own digital camera, I will very
seriously consider gettting a Mavica.  I photographed
the lace edging that I did for Pauline's heart using
the Mavica.  You can see it on Lori's lacefairy site
http://lace.lacefairy.com 

I remember that the floppy version held about 10 high
quality photos on a floppy (70? low quality pictures.)
 The CD held about 100 high quality pictures and 600
low quality ones.  It was a 3.2 megapixel camera. 
Heavy, but nice.

> Windows NT is also very unlikely to work with any
> current camera, as all the
> one's I've seen use USB and Windows NT cannot do
> USB.<<<
> 
> There's still the Mavica type cameras.  The older
> Mavicas recorded directly
> onto floppy disk, so you didn't need any particular
> kind of ports or
> software--just something that could read jpegs.  The
> newer Mavicas record
> onto CDs, so there should still be no worry about
> operating system or ports.
> 
> 
> I took many excellent pictures on my floppy-Mavica. 
> It got closer than an
> inch to the subject, so I could get great
> magnification of embroidery and
> lace.  Unless it was behind glass--the autofocus
> focussed on the glass, and
> when you're only 2 inches away, the 1/2 inch between
> the top of the glass
> and the lace is 25% off, so out of focus.  Then you
> have to back up and use
> telephoto.
